ORLANDO, Fla. —
Afternoon storms on Friday could bring damaging wind and hail to parts of Central Florida.
The First Warning Weather Team is calling for Impact Weather from 3-8 p.m.

A few storms could be strong to severe for areas north of Orlando.
Widespread severe storms are not expected, but storms could impact events like Welcome To Rockville.
Models show rain in Daytona Beach, DeLand and to the north at 6 p.m.

What is Impact Weather?
Impact Weather suggests weather conditions could be disruptive or a nuisance for travel and day-to-day activities.
What is a Severe Weather Warning Day?
A Severe Weather Warning Day suggests weather conditions that could potentially harm life or property.
